🌡️ PolyWeather: Real-time Weather Query & Analysis Bot
An intelligent weather information bot designed to provide ultra-fast, live meteorological data, high-fidelity forecasts, and smart trend analysis. Built for speed and accuracy, it bypasses network caching to deliver the most up-to-date reports from global weather stations.
🚀 Quick Start
Requirements
- Python 3.11+
- Dependencies:
pip install -r requirements.txt
Running Locally (Windows/Linux)
# Windows
py -3.11 run.py
# Linux/VPS
python3 run.py
Note: The system is currently in Weather Query Mode. Active market monitoring and automated trading modules are suspended.

✨ Key Features
1. 💡 Intelligent Trend Analysis
The bot doesn't just show numbers; it performs a Live vs. Forecast analysis:
- Peak Detection: Determines if the daily high has likely already passed.
- Atmospheric Physics: Uses humidity and dew point to predict if the temperature will "stall" at night.
- Volatility Alerts: Flags high wind speeds that might cause rapid temperature swings.
2. ✈️ High-Fidelity Airport Data (METAR)
Directly connected to NOAA Aviation Weather, the bot fetches raw METAR data from major international airports.
- Automatic conversion from UTC to City Local Time.
- Real-time station observations (Temperature, Wind, Dew Point).
3. ⚡ Ultra-Fresh Data (Cache Busting)
Engineered to bypass ISP and proxy caches:
- Every request includes a micro-timestamp token.
- Forces weather servers (Open-Meteo/NOAA) to deliver fresh results instead of stale cached snapshots.
🏗️ Architecture Note
The project contains a legacy Monitoring Engine and Paper Trading System (located in main.py). These features are currently deactivated to prioritize high-speed on-demand weather reporting.
